09:41 — Bucketloom assignment service began returning default variants for ~8% of requests. Cause: config push truncated the experiment registry. Alarms fired on assignment-miss rate at 09:44. Rolled back registry at 09:52; miss rate recovered by 09:55. Downstream metrics pipelines ingested ~14 minutes of polluted assignment events; experiments active in that window were flagged for re-analysis. Action items: add registry checksum validation pre-push, lower miss-rate alarm threshold. Affected deployment is identified below.

trace token, fafog-kageg: htk4_98e6

## Onboarding — Markdown Pipeline (Inkmere)

Inkmere docs render through a three-stage pipeline: parse, sanitize, emit. Releases rebuild all templates; never hot-patch emitted HTML. Broken renders usually mean a sanitizer rule change — check the rules diff first. The render cluster only accepts builds from the release channel, and every build artifact must be signed before upload. Sign artifacts with the deploy key below.

release key, hafop-tajef: bky13_s2vaFVNJTHfBL

### Action Item: Spoolhaven Retry Storm

From last Tuesday's outage: the Spoolhaven print service retried failed jobs without backoff, saturating the render pool. Fix merged; retries now use capped exponential backoff with jitter. Owner will monitor for a week before closing. The agreed retry constants are recorded below.

constants for yadup-kajof:
RATE_LIMITS = {
    "zorwyn": 1,
    "druwyn": 1,
}